Fear or taking cover? The truth about policeman spotted “hiding under flowers”

After the gruesome murder of Police spokesman AIGP Andrew Felix Kaweesi, there has been a strong wave of fear in the country. The AIGP, his body guard and driver were murdered in a manner that shocked Ugandans.



So, with the increased vigilance, Ugandans have taken this “security consciousness” to a whole other level that even the CCTV cameras might be of secondary importance. This photo of a policeman presumably “hiding under a hedge” shocked many Ugandans.

Many have been claiming the Policeman was hiding from a security threat. Others joked that he was one of the “security cameras” that had been installed. 

However, it turns out, the Policeman was somewhere on I.U.I.U campus Mbale and was trespassing. He was caught by camera in position that portrayed him as one “hiding” but it had nothing to do with security threats. He was simply trespassing!
